On Okt 22 2016, Eli Zaretskii <eliz@gnu.org> wrote:
>> I think this could be provoked by some lisp stuff I currently develop
>> that does a lot of consing, dunno (but of cause I don't funcall `crash'
>> anywhere, at least not willingly :-) ). Crashs happen every ten minutes or
>> so, and at totally random points.
>>
>> Here is the gdb output. Session still open.
>> [...]
>>
>> (gdb) bt full
>> #0 0x000000000058aae0 in unchain_marker (marker=0x88e9968) at marker.c:605
>> tail = 0x2020200020202020 <<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<
>> prev = 0x2020200020202030 <<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<
>
> Your marker pointers are actually full of blank (and other ASCII)
> characters. So some code somewhere either writes past the end of some
> stack-based array or otherwise overwrites the stack.
More likely, BUF_MARKERS is already overwritten. (The "other ASCII
character" comes from the offset of ->next). What do the other contents
of b->text look like? Finding the place where a member of a struct
buffer is overwritten can be done with a watchpoint.
